The visa applicant need to be legally acceptable to the USA, go to the very least 18 years of ages, plan to use up lawful permanent home in the United States, and meet the legal definition of a certified capitalist. Targeted work areas are geographic locations with an unemployment price of at the very least 150% of the national standard at the time of the application and financial investment.
Once the capitalist verifies the high unemployment criterion, they may certify for a smaller sized investment, according to immigration legislation. High unemployment rates can be gathered either through public records or by getting a letter from a certified state government company. Another way to identify a TEA is if it is considered a rural location.

If you fulfill every one of the requirements for the EB-5 capitalist program, you may be qualified to use for an environment-friendly card (authorized copyright card). You will certainly get a conditional residence copyright at initially, and then you will require to verify to the government that you have promoted your end of the bargain with your investment and application for the government to get rid of problems to ensure that you can get a long-term environment-friendly card.

In the realm of EB-5 financial investments, the majority of financial investments are structured to satisfy the needs of a Targeted Work Area (TEA). By locating the financial investment in a TEA, capitalists come to be qualified for the lower investment limit, which presently straight from the source stands at $800,000. Spending in a TEA not only allows financiers to make a reduced capital expense however likewise supplies a new class of visas that have no waiting line, and investments right into a backwoods receive top priority processing.
These non-TEA jobs might provide various financial investment opportunities and task types, providing to capitalists with varying choices and purposes. Eventually, the choice to invest in a TEA or non-TEA job depends on a person's financial abilities, financial investment objectives, threat tolerance, and positioning with their individual choices.
